1

actionscript 用にエクスポートしてから addChild を後で追加するムービークリップを用意することで、私は巧妙になっていると思いました。as を介して html テキストをロードするこの 1 つのムービークリップを作成しました。これをステージにドラッグすると正常に動作します。しかし、私がそうするなら

var trackListingBox:trackListingScreen = new trackListingScreen();
addChild(trackListingBox);

アクションスクリプトを実行していないか、何らかの理由で壊れています。子供は自分のアクション スクリプトを実行できませんか?

4

3 に答える 3

0

ムービー クリップがステージに追加されたときに起動するコードを MovieClip に追加してみてください。このようなもの:

this.addEventListener(Event.ADDED_TO_STAGE,onAddedToStage);
function onAddedToStage(e:Event):void {
functionWhichLoadsHTML();
}
于 2010-06-07T15:13:21.090 に答える
0

彼らは「独自のアクションスクリプトを実行する」ことができます。子クリップのコードにバグがある可能性がありますが、コードを実際に見ないとアドバイスできません。

于 2010-06-07T19:28:00.510 に答える
0

問題は、actionscript が参照しているアイテムの前に読み込まれていたため、アイテムが見つからないというエラーが発生したことでした。

于 2010-06-10T05:20:03.890 に答える